Do you like fresh vegetables and helping people? The Giving Garden is an outreach ministry of Thomasville First United Methodist Church that seeks to eliminate food insecurity and recognize assets. It’s a place to spend time together and be the agents in which God restores the world. During the week you are invited to weed, harvest, assess overall garden health, and bring the harvested food to the church for storage, which is then brought to the pay-what-you-can market on Saturday mornings from 8:30 am to 10 am (at the garden).

Also, the garden is funded by donations (pay-what-you-can) during the Saturday morning market. If you choose to come and get your vegetables from the Giving Garden and make a donation, that is a big help! There are many ways to contribute to the Giving Garden.
